MAIN PURPOSE OF JOB:
To operate the Mixer in a safe and professional manner, delivering products to customers and to provide excellent customer service
RELATIONSHIPS;
Responsible to: Concrete Manager
Responsible for: None
Liaison with: Directors, Managers, Employees, Clients, Suppliers.
D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
MAIN TASKS OF JOB:
- Daily Inspections to be carried out prior to driving.
- Ensure you have received your work schedule via electronic device or transport office.
- Supervise the loading of the vehicle so that products are safely encumbered and secure to minimise chances of damage.
- Ensure with Batcher that the load is correct against the customers’ orders.
- Ensure that on arrival the delivery is safe to execute and respect customer’s property; if in doubt, consult with customer and/or Transport Manager/ Batcher, and use disclaimers if necessary.
- Check goods off with Customers and obtain signature and print. If any errors mark ticket accordingly and consult with Batcher as appropriate.
- Handle customer issues on delivery effectively. Contact Ready Mix Manager or Batcher for assistance if required.
- Carry out deliveries in a timely and safe manner and provide excellent customer service.
- Drive the vehicle safely and in accordance with the law.
- Drive within the tachograph law and driver hours limits.
- Maintain condition of the vehicle and ensure that it is not subjected to unnecessary damage both externally and inside the drum.
- Complete any maintenance on vehicle.
- Maintain the cleanliness of the driving cab.
- Comply with fuel directives from the Transport Department.
- Report any accidents as soon as possible and in compliance with the company’s accident reporting procedure
- PPE to worn around Plant and Site
- To comply with the company’s Health, Safety and Environmental policy, highlighting any issues appropriately.
- To act in accordance with the company’s Health, Safety and Environmental policies, procedures and practices.
- Performs other duties as directed
